Bieber's Valentine's plan

Justin Bieber will release his long-awaited new album, Changes, on Valentine's Day, the star has confirmed.

The singer's musical comeback is in full swing, after he dropped the new tune Yummy earlier this month, and released the first instalment of his new docuseries Seasons on Monday.

During an appearance on The Ellen DeGeneres Show, the 25-year-old musician revealed his new album, Changes, will finally be released on Feb. 14.

Justin also revealed details of a massive North American tour, which kicks off on May 14 in Seattle and plays stadiums and arenas across the U.S. before wrapping on Sept. 26 in East Rutherford, New Jersey.

The star's return to the spotlight comes after he revealed a debilitating battle with tick-borne illness Lyme Disease plagued him over the past two years, confessing at an album playback event in Los Angeles last week: "I don't even think I should be alive... I feel like God's brought me out of a really dark place."

After announcing the news, Justin dropped the second track from the record, Get Me featuring Kehlani, which is available to download and stream now.
